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-9 ACMG points: 2P and 11B. PM2BP4_StrongBP6_ModerateBP7BS1

The NM_001129.5(AEBP1):​c.213G>T​(p.Ala71=)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000641 in 1,560,198 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★).

Genes affected
AEBP1 (HGNC:303): (AE binding protein 1) This gene encodes a member of carboxypeptidase A protein family. The encoded protein may function as a transcriptional repressor and play a role in adipogenesis and smooth muscle cell differentiation. Studies in mice suggest that this gene functions in wound healing and abdominal wall development. Overexpression of this gene is associated with glioblastoma. [provided by RefSeq, May 2013]
